In the matters of Micron Manufacturing Pty Ltd and Micron Group Pty Ltd [2017] NSWSC 289
Exceptional circumstances were established given plaintiff's exclusion from company and necessity of documents for expert valuation. Disclosure for specified financial categories ordered. Complete access to MYOB system not warranted at this stage; further requests to be made as needed by experts.

Legal Issues
- 1 ["Whether 'exceptional circumstances' exist justifying disclosure prior to service of all evidence under Practice Note SC Eq 11 and UCPR r 21.2" "Whether requested documents are necessary for party's expert valuation report" 'Whether restrictions should be imposed due to confidentiality claims']
Ratio Decidendi
Exceptional circumstances were established given plaintiff's exclusion from company and necessity of documents for expert valuation. Disclosure for specified financial categories ordered. Complete access to MYOB system not warranted at this stage; further requests to be made as needed by experts.
